Development of microfluidic analytical method for on-line gaseous Formaldehyde detection

Abstract: Highlights • Novel analytical micro-device for quantification of gaseous formaldehyde • Gaseous Formaldehyde uptake through the establishment of a microfluidic annular flow • Formaldehyde detection using colorimetric cell using a liquid-core-waveguide
